Fundamental Taekwondo Methods for Protection
To efficiently protect yourself making use of Taekwondo, it's necessary to master basic techniques that enable you to react promptly and emphatically in any type of self-defense scenario.
One of the essential methods in Taekwondo is the front kick. This technique entails raising your knee to your breast and expanding your leg ahead, intending to strike your challenger's upper body or confront with the ball of your foot.
Another important method is the roundhouse kick. With this kick, you pivot on your supporting foot and swing your leg in a circular activity, intending to strike your opponent's body or head with the top of your foot or shin.
The side kick is another efficient technique, involving a fast and powerful drive of your leg to strike your challenger's belly.
Effective Strategies for Utilizing Taekwondo in Real-Life Situations
After mastering the standard strategies of Taekwondo for self-defense, it's important to create effective techniques that can be applied in real-life situations.
Right here are 3 crucial strategies to aid you utilize Taekwondo successfully:
- Keep calmness and concentrated: In a real-life situation, it's simple to worry or come to be overloaded. However, by staying calm and concentrated, you can believe extra clearly and make better decisions.
- Use your environments: Taekwondo isn't just about kicks and punches. It has to do with using your environment to your benefit. Search for objects that can be used for defense or to develop distance in between you and your enemy.
- Aim for weak points: When defending on your own, go for the weak points of your aggressor. Strikes to the eyes, throat, groin, or knees can promptly disable a challenger and offer you the edge.
